Transaction 107d03fff44f9a5d9df19e6c33d1134df8a4556381105a2866d704a5c48d5c38

72 Input
1 Outputs
  • 107d03fff44f9a5d9df19e6c33d1134df8a4556381105a2866d704a5c48d5c38:0
  • value  808874872
    address  bc1q4c8n5t00jmj8temxdgcc3t32nkg2wjwz24lywv